How to Secure Etsy Insurance Claim

As an Etsy seller, it is important to consider how to protect your business from unexpected events that could result in financial loss. One way to do this is by securing insurance for your Etsy shop. In this guide, we will discuss the steps you need to take to secure an Etsy insurance claim and protect your business.

Step 1: Assess Your Insurance Needs

Before you start shopping for insurance, it is important to assess your insurance needs. This involves identifying the potential risks your business could face and determining the type of insurance coverage you need. Common insurance coverage options for Etsy sellers include general liability insurance,product liability insurance, andbusiness property insurance.

Step 2: Research Insurance Providers

Once you have assessed your insurance needs, it is time to research insurance providers. Look for insurance providers that specialize insmall business insuranceand have experience working with Etsy sellers. It is also important to read reviews and compare rates to ensure you are getting the best coverage for your budget.

Step 3: Purchase Insurance Coverage

After you have found an insurance provider that meets your needs, it is time to purchase insurance coverage. Be sure to carefully review the policy before signing to ensure you understand the coverage limits, deductibles, and any exclusions that may apply.

Step 4: Document Your Inventory

In the event of an insurance claim, it is important to have documentation of your inventory. Take photos and keep a record of all items you sell on Etsy, including their value and any unique features. This will help you provide proof of loss in the event of a claim.

Step 5: Report Incidents Promptly

If your business experiences an incident that may result in an insurance claim, it is important to report it promptly to your insurance provider. This includes incidents such as theft, damage to your business property, or customer injuries. Failing to report incidents in a timely manner could result in a denial of coverage.

Conclusion

Securing insurance coverage for your Etsy shop is an important step in protecting your business from unexpected events that could result in financial loss. By taking the time to assess your insurance needs, research providers, purchase coverage, document your inventory, andreport incidents promptly, you can help ensure you are fully protected. Additionally, it is important to regularly review and update your insurance coverage as your business grows and changes.
